Understanding Tooth Pain and Its Causes

Now, let us take a glimpse at what causes teeth aches, which is a crucial consideration when searching for solutions. The pain can stem from various factors, including:

  • Tooth Decay: The most frequent type arises from bacterial involvement leading to enamel loss.
  • Gum Disease: Some of the effects that are associated with inflamed gums include sensitive teeth and toothache.
  • Dental Abscess: An infection is painful and needs medical treatment as soon as possible.
  • Teeth Grinding (Bruxism): This makes teeth vulnerable to wear and tear and exposes nerve endings, causing pain.

Symptoms of Tooth Pain

Knowing some signs that point to the likelihood of tooth pain can help you know the severity of your case. Common symptoms include:

  • Stabbing, burning, or aching discomfort
  • The feeling of hot or cold temperatures
  • Pain when biting or chewing
  • Swelling in the gums or around the affected tooth
  • Bad taste or odor

It is vital to deal with any of the symptoms stated above as soon as possible.

Over-the-Counter Pain Relievers

Using different drugs like ibuprofen or acetaminophen are ways that are believed to kill tooth pain instantly. Please read the instructions on the pack, and if you have any questions, consult a doctor.

Topical Anesthetics

Products that have benzocaine can help numb the area within a short while. Use a small amount of the product for application directly to the affected tooth and gum.

Prevention Tips for Lasting Relief

As much as it is important to know ways how to kill tooth pain nerve in 3 seconds permanently, it is also equally important to avoid toothache as much as possible. Here are some tips to maintain optimal dental health:

Maintain Oral Hygiene

To avoid plaque formation and dental caries, brush your teeth at least twice daily and floss. Fluoride toothpaste should be used in order to offer more protection.

Regular Dental Check-Ups

Maintain a routine dental check-up and cleaning appointment with your dentist. This is because underlying problems may reach an extent where severe pain and complications could develop.

Healthy Diet

Avoid frequent intake of sweets and soft, acidic drinks that make teeth rotten. As much as possible, eat fruits, vegetables, and whole-grain foods.

Stay Hydrated

Drinking water clears the mouth, washing away food particles and bacteria that cause cavities, giving a clean mouth.

Avoid Grinding Your Teeth

People who tend to clench their jaws at night should wear a mouth guard to avoid affecting the nerves of their teeth.
